Hi Guys, Just wanted to share with you all that London Visa office does accept property valuation as proof of funds but it should not be bound under any mortgage..... i sent them an email few days back and this is what their reply said...

Thank you for your enquiry.

 

In support of your application, you should provide proof of unencumbered and readily transferable funds in a convertible

currency that is available to you for settlement in Canada (for you and your family members):

• current bank certification letter; or

• evidence of savings balance; or

• fixed or time deposit statements.

 

Before approving an application, the immigration officer must be satisfied that you have sufficient funds to support yourself and your family when you first arrive in Canada. The Government of Canada does not provide financial support to new skilled worker immigrants.

 

When first arriving in Canada as a permanent resident you will also need to show immigration officials at the port of entry that you have sufficient transferable funds for your settlement in Canada.

 

You can show bank statements or saving statements or value of your property after the repayment of your mortgage. 

 

If you have been offered a job or if you are going to work in Canada on a temporary work permit you may present proof of your salary.

Hi Nevil,

Sealed transcripts are required if you have done bachelors or masters degree from the university but if you have done a proffesional diploma/certificate then you only need to send the notarized copy of the certificate/ diploma.

Professional qualifications certificates: notarized professional qualifications certificates should be submitted if available. (e.g., Engineer, Computer Programmer, Accountant, Economist, Translator/Interpreter, Architect etc.)
